Kilkenny Borough council is currently
chaired by the Mayor, Fine Gael’s Pat Crotty.
There are twelve elected members. The
current party breakdown is: four Fianna Fáil, four Fine Gael, three
Labour and one Green.
The balance of power is held by Fine
Gael and Labour.
Some of the key issues for the council are
unfinished housing estates and properties, maintaining business in the
city centre, anti-social behaviour and the Central Access Scheme.
